Tell Me Lies remains a definitive pillar of psychological drama television, having concluded its influential run on Hulu. The series carved out a unique space in the streaming landscape by dissecting the mechanics of a toxic, decade-long obsession with unflinching honesty. By moving away from traditional romantic tropes and instead focusing on the gaslighting and emotional manipulation inherent in Stephen and Lucy's relationship, the show resonated with a generation of viewers familiar with the complexities of modern dating. Its legacy is defined by its ability to spark intense online discourse regarding red flags and the psychological toll of codependency, making it a benchmark for character-driven narratives that prioritize realism over sanitized resolutions.
Fans return to the series repeatedly because of its meticulous world-building and the visceral performances of its lead cast. The show functions as a time capsule of early 2000s collegiate life while maintaining a timeless quality through its exploration of secrets and the ripple effects of a single lie. As a rewatch staple, it offers new layers of foreshadowing and character motivation upon subsequent viewings, cementing its status as a dark, addictive masterpiece of the genre.
